Download torrents python
If you're executing this cell by cell in an Interactive window, you'll immediately see that a new torrent file appears in both web UI and qBittorrent desktop client as the following figure shows:. Awesome, you can use the savepath parameter to save the resulting file to the path you actually want:.
You can also do various things, for instance, let's pause all torrents in the client:. Or you can resume them:. Or even listing them and showing some useful information:.
Here is my output:. You can also pause and resume specific torrent files using their hash value, this wrapper is rich with useful methods, please check their full API method documentation and the GitHub repository.
Alright, that's it for this tutorial, this will make you open to many cool challenges, here is an example challenge:. Sign in Sign up. Instantly share code, notes, and snippets. Last active Nov 18, Code Revisions 2 Stars 20 Forks Embed What would you like to do? Embed Embed this gist in your website. Share Copy sharable link for this gist.
Simple and functional BitTorrent client made in Python - Use for learning. I wanted to make my own functional and straightforward program to learn how does BitTorrent protocol work and improve my python skills. It is almost written from scratch with python 3. You first need to wait for the program to connect to some peers first, then it starts downloading.
Don't hesitate to ask me questions if you need help, or send me a pull request for new features or improvements. If you want to specify a torrent file, you need to edit it manually in the main. Introducing Content Health, a new way to keep the knowledge base up-to-date. Podcast what if you could invest in your favorite developer? Featured on Meta.
Now live: A fully responsive profile. Reducing the weight of our footer. Linked 7. Related Hot Network Questions. Question feed. Stack Overflow works best with JavaScript enabled. Accept all cookies Customize settings.
0コメント